Unlock Your Potential with Garuda888
Are you prepared to embark on a world of thrilling wins? Look no further than Garuda888, your trusted companion for securing the ultimate victory. With our cutting-edge platform and wide selection of games, we assure a memorable gaming journey. Immerse into the heart of excitement with our compelling range of games. From timeless favorites to innov